With its central location, Millennium Hotel is within easy reach of most tourist ... more
attractions and business addresses in Glasgow. The hotel has a total of 117 well-appointed rooms designed with the guests' comfort in mind. Each guestroom features amenities such as non smoking rooms, air conditioning, bathrobes, inhouse movies, desk, hair dryer. Hotel facilities offered at this Glasgow accommodation include room service 24hr, elevator, bar/pub, laundry service/dry cleaning, meeting facilities . Hotel's guests can experience on-site latest leisure and sports facilities such as gym/fitness facilities. After deciding to take a trip to Glasgow for a few days, my husband and I set out to find a good value hotel. After looking at the usual Travelodges and Premier Travel Inns, we came across the Campanile hotel which is like the French version of Travelodge. It was 52 pounds a night and had a secure car park, something which we found very good as parking in Glasgow tends to be quite expensive. Although the price was good we decided to shop around and managed to book 3 nights for 122 pounds on Expedia.
The location of the hotel was very good as it was in the newly upgraded and developed area near the SECC and surrounding the hotel was luxury apartments, the new Clyde Arc bridge, the new STV and BBC Scotland studios and the SECC and Glasgow Science Centre. Millennium Hotel Glasgow is at the very centre of the city\\\'s cultural and retail activities. This striking Victorian building with its impressive facade offers modern amenities and impeccable service. Savour the delights of the various museums and galleries that are nearby or take a trip out of the city to Loch Lomond, The Trossachs or Ayrshire coast. Millenium Hotel Glasgow, re-opened in June 2000 on George Square at the very heart of this vibrant and welcoming city, further to an extensive and award winning refurbishment programme. Millennium Hotel Glasgow\\\'s lounge serves the most sophisticated cappucino in the city centre, offering a great place to relax and watch the world go by.
